Hi Eveyrone,
Just thouhgt id post a quick link to our new Society. This currently runs with around 16 non TSG members who i have just invited.
My intention is to make this grow and therefore would welcome any new members.
We currently run a very relaxed society, i like to think of it as more friends meeting for a game of golf. Games are posted once a month, where we all play and share some laughs and a drink or two after. A small kitty is played for during the game, with the top 10 players being award points. We find this also helps everyone with a tight money budget stay involved.
At the end of the year, we have a full on day, with a nice meal and prize giving for that years winners & all winners of the added compertions on the day.
We also hold a full day at the start of each year, consider it a welcoming game.
Feel free to join, we are a great bunch with every level of golfer.
